Celebrate Sustainably: Festive Upcycles
As we approach the holiday season, it's the perfect time to embrace sustainability and get creative with festive upcycles. Upcycling is the process of transforming old or unused items into something new and beautiful, reducing waste and giving new life to forgotten objects. Not only is upcycling environmentally friendly, but it also adds a unique touch to your celebrations. Here are some fun and eco-friendly upcycling ideas to make your holidays more sustainable:
1. Repurposed Decorations
Instead of buying new decorations every year, why not repurpose items you already have at home? Turn old jars into twinkling candle holders, transform wine corks into festive ornaments, or create a garland using leftover fabric scraps. These DIY decorations not only look charming but also help reduce waste.
2. Upcycled Gift Wrapping
Skip the traditional wrapping paper that often ends up in the trash and opt for upcycled alternatives. Use old newspapers, fabric scraps, or even maps to wrap your gifts creatively. Finish off with a reusable ribbon or twine for a rustic and sustainable touch.
3. Sustainable Table Settings
Set a beautiful and eco-friendly table by upcycling items for your table settings. Use mason jars as drinking glasses, repurpose old fabric as napkins, or create unique placeholders using natural materials like pinecones or twigs. Your table will not only look stunning but also showcase your commitment to sustainability.
4. DIY Upcycled Ornaments
Gather your family and friends for a fun crafting session to create DIY upcycled ornaments. Use old light bulbs, bottle caps, or cardboard to make unique decorations for your tree. Not only will this activity bring everyone together, but it will also add a personal touch to your holiday decor.
